From 44bd6f8362f2a351fc5264c8a196030cf0020e77 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E6=9D=8E=E4=BC=9F=E8=B6=85?= Date: Mon, 21 Oct 2019 13:11:05 +0800 Subject: [PATCH] fix(async): fix async configuration order --- .../async/CustomAsyncConfigurerAutoConfiguration.java | 7 +------ 1 file changed, 1 insertion(+), 6 deletions(-) diff --git a/instrument-starters/opentracing-spring-cloud-core/src/main/java/io/opentracing/contrib/spring/cloud/async/CustomAsyncConfigurerAutoConfiguration.java b/instrument-starters/opentracing-spring-cloud-core/src/main/java/io/opentracing/contrib/spring/cloud/async/CustomAsyncConfigurerAutoConfiguration.java index a1654410..5baa0c17 100644 --- a/instrument-starters/opentracing-spring-cloud-core/src/main/java/io/opentracing/contrib/spring/cloud/async/CustomAsyncConfigurerAutoConfiguration.java +++ b/instrument-starters/opentracing-spring-cloud-core/src/main/java/io/opentracing/contrib/spring/cloud/async/CustomAsyncConfigurerAutoConfiguration.java @@ -25,7 +25,6 @@ import org.springframework.boot.autoconfigure.condition.ConditionalOnBean; import org.springframework.boot.autoconfigure.condition.ConditionalOnProperty; import org.springframework.context.annotation.Configuration; -import org.springframework.core.PriorityOrdered; import org.springframework.scheduling.annotation.AsyncConfigurer; /** @@ -40,7 +39,7 @@ @AutoConfigureBefore(DefaultAsyncAutoConfiguration.class) @AutoConfigureAfter(TracerAutoConfiguration.class) @ConditionalOnProperty(name = "opentracing.spring.cloud.async.enabled", havingValue = "true", matchIfMissing = true) -public class CustomAsyncConfigurerAutoConfiguration implements BeanPostProcessor,PriorityOrdered { +public class CustomAsyncConfigurerAutoConfiguration implements BeanPostProcessor { @Autowired private Tracer tracer; @@ -60,8 +59,4 @@ public Object postProcessAfterInitialization(Object bean, String beanName) throw return bean; } - @Override - public int getOrder() { - return PriorityOrdered.LOWEST_PRECEDENCE; - } }